OBD II Fault Code
- OBD II P0164
The purpose of the oxygen sensor is to measure the oxygen content in the exhaust gases after they leave the combustion process of the engine. This information is critical to the PCM's ability to maintain efficient fuel economy. When the PCM detects a failure of the sensor or the information received from the sensor, it will set code P0164.
Decreased engine performance Symptoms
- Decreased engine performance
- Increased fuel consumption
Common Problems That Trigger the P0164 Code
- Exhaust leak
- Oxygen sensor failure
- Powertrain Control Module (PCM) failure
- Wiring issue

Lexus fault code p1604
P1604 Lexus Description
The P1604 code is stored if the engine does not start or continues to crank without starting for a certain period of time. The P1604 code is also stored if the vehicle has run out of fuel. It is necessary to check whether there was enough fuel in the fuel tank before performing this inspection.
